2700 East Long Lane, Greenwood Village, CO 80121
Details
Photos
Map
Request Info
Brochure
Photos for 2700 East Long Lane, Greenwood Village, CO 80121
Aerial View
2700 East Long Lane, Greenwood Village, CO 80121